I set my feed cycle as followsā¦this is hydro in clay
Lights on, 5 minutes later 1st feed,then every 3 hrs. Veg cycle that 6 feedings on 18hr lights.
Bloom cycle thatās 4 feedings on 12hr lights.
On my top feed system, 15 minute on cycle.
Flood tables system, 8-10 minutes on.
@Joshmcginnis28 I am just about done with a grow using a flood and drain system, will probably flush in another week. I did mine in buckets but same general ideal. For my grow I started with the GH root cups. Once they took root in those I put them into the clay pebbles root cup and all. At 3 weeks I had them on 18/6 light cycles and (3) 15 minute watering cycles. The light was raised up higher and turned down which ended up being a mistake because of stretch. You can pull a couple photos from previous posts I made. The flood & drain process has been on cruise control the entire time, change the water once a week and keep it Phād. My mix recipe is below in the correct mixing order per General Hydroponics.
Armor Si (circulate this for 10 minutes or so before adding anything else)
Cali Magic
Floranova grow/bloom
Floralicious grow/bloom
Liquid Kool Bloom
UC Roots
Water temp is critical, I added a chiller to my system to keep it at 70f
